Ted Daffan and His Texans – Broken Vows Shut That Gate
Label: Columbia – 37087
Format: Shellac, 10", 78 RPM, Single
Released: June 1946
Genre: Folk, World, and Country
Style: Country
A: Broken Vows
Composer– Daffan
Vocals – George Strange
With String Band Accompaniment
B: Shut That Gate
Composers– D. James, Daffan
Theron Eugene "Ted" Daffan (September 21, 1912 – October 6, 1996) was an American country musician noted for composing the seminal "Truck Driver's Blues" and two much covered country anthems of unrequited love, "Born to Lose" and "I'm a Fool to Care".
